P4KE22CATR belongs to the category of transient voltage suppressor diodes.
These diodes are used to protect sensitive electronic components from voltage transients induced by lightning, inductive load switching, and electrostatic discharge.
P4KE22CATR is typically available in a DO-41 package.
The essence of P4KE22CATR lies in its ability to divert excessive current away from sensitive components, thereby safeguarding them from damage due to voltage spikes.
These diodes are comm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.
P4KE22CATR typically consists of two pins, anode, and cathode, which are identified by a color band or marking on the body of the diode.
When a voltage transient occurs, the P4KE22CATR diode conducts and diverts the excess current away from the protected components, limiting the voltage across them to a safe level.
P4KE22CATR is widely used in various electronic systems, including: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ems
